pub enum Advanced {
Show 26 variants
Hood,
Bevor,
Rondel,
Gorget,
Rerebrace,
Couter,
Chausses,
Plackart,
Cuisses,
Chestplate,
Curiass,
Fauld,
Poleyn,
Greaves,
Sabaton,
Spaulders,
Pauldron,
Vambrace,
Gauntlets,
Hauberk,
Helmet,
Neckguard,
Faceplate,
Coat,
Tasset,
None,
}
Variants§
Hood
Hood armor
Bevor
Jaw / throat armor
Rondel
Circular plate armor protecting various areas
Gorget
Collar armor
Rerebrace
Upper arm armor below the shoulder armor
Couter
Elbow Armor
Chausses
Pant armor
Plackart
Belly armor
Cuisses
Thigh armor
Chestplate
Front torso armor
Curiass
Torso armor
Fauld
Waist and hip armor
Poleyn
Knee armor
Greaves
Shin armor
Sabaton
Shoe armor
Spaulders
Shoulder / upper arm guard
Pauldron
Shoulder / armpit (back/chest optional) armor
Vambrace
Forearm guard
Gauntlets
Hand guard
Hauberk
Shirt armor
Helmet
Head Armor
Neckguard
Neck Armor
Faceplate
Face armor
Coat
The coat worn over armor
Tasset
Hanging upper thigh plate armor
None
No armor
Trait Implementations§
Source§impl<T: Copy + Default + Debug + AddAssign + Add<Output = T> + Div<Output = T> + DivAssign + Mul<Output = T> + MulAssign + Neg<Output = T> + Rem<Output = T> + RemAssign + Sub<Output = T> + SubAssign + PartialOrd + NumCast> Builder<T> for Advanced
impl<T: Copy + Default + Debug + AddAssign + Add<Output = T> + Div<Output = T> + DivAssign + Mul<Output = T> + MulAssign + Neg<Output = T> + Rem<Output = T> + RemAssign + Sub<Output = T> + SubAssign + PartialOrd + NumCast> Builder<T> for Advanced
Source§fn build_basic(&self, id: T, level: T) -> BasicStats<T>
fn build_basic(&self, id: T, level: T) -> BasicStats<T>
Build a
Basic
statfn build_normal(&self, id: T, level: T) -> NormalStats<T>
fn build_advanced(&self, id: T, level: T) -> AdvancedStats<T>
Source§impl<'de> Deserialize<'de> for Advanced
impl<'de> Deserialize<'de> for Advanced
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l Random for Advanced
impl Random for Advanced
impl Copy for Advanced
impl Eq for Advanced
impl StructuralPartialEq for Advanced
Auto Trait Implementations§
impl Freeze for Advanced
impl RefUnwindSafe for Advanced
impl Send for Advanced
impl Sync for Advanced
impl Unpin for Advanced
impl UnwindSafe for Advanced
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more